Friday Race #10: SKMaddy GR-3 5 F on the Turf.

M-L favorite :4: Firsthand Report is one of the worst favorites on the card. The highest speed figure this girl has run is at 1 1/16. This race has a ton of speed in it and the last time she saw a pace like this at this distance she gave up. there are 4 horses in here that I like.

:1: So Sweetitiz 6-1 Has shown the ability to handle the pace and still finish well. But the layoff is really bothersome.

:3: Instant Reflex 15-1 1st race of her life showed the ability to handle the pace. Stretched out in last and might have proved she is a sprinter at this moment, but has potential.

:9: Long Hot Summer 9-2 One of only 2 runners in this race that has shown ability to run off the pace. Has the speed figures to win and gets the edge to be on top.

:10: Street Surrender 8-1 The "other" off the pace runner in here, but has really shown to be a distance horse and not a sprinter. The fact that she just might come running at the end makes her a contender here.

Most people on race days like this just bet with the rest of the crowd. Horses can have similar data and one will be 3-1 and the other 20-1. Many times it's really minor drawbacks that make the difference in those odds. Experienced bettors are accustomed to betting their own states product, and aren't as skilled at betting fields of horses that have not seen each other before. Especially in 2 year old races, and turf fields.
